Spalding train station is equipped to meet the needs of every traveller. Ticket purchasing is straightforward with both a ticket office and machines available, ensuring you can seamlessly collect tickets bought online. While there are no smartcards issued at the station, you will find validators for your convenience.
Accessibility is a top priority here, with step-free access spanning the entirety of the station. Lifts and tactile paving ensure ease of movement, while accessible ticket machines and induction loops cater to various needs. Despite the absence of waiting lounges or refreshments, basic facilities like toilets (including accessible ones) are well-maintained.
Travelers will appreciate the well-managed car park operated by East Midlands Railway, with ample parking spaces, including three designated for accessible use, and an option to pay via RingGO.
Spalding station offers simple onward travel options. For connections beyond the rail network, you’ll find a convenient taxi rank and a bus stop for any rail replacement services right outside the station. With several local taxi services like 1st Choice and Mels on call, getting to and around Spalding is a breeze. Though small, Pontefract Tanshelf station is equipped with essential ticketing facilities. There is no traditional ticket office; however, passengers can take advantage of available ticket machines to collect online purchases and buy tickets for their journey. While the station does not offer accessible ticket machines or major amenities such as lounges or waiting rooms, it ensures safety and security through its CCTV installation.
For those requiring additional assistance, the station encourages the use of the help line, though it lacks an on-site staff support system. Accessibility is well considered with step-free access provided, allowing ease of movement for those with impaired mobility. Passengers can navigate the station without encountering barriers, thanks to a ramped footbridge available for platform access. Moreover, if travel assistance is needed, passengers can utilize the Passenger Assist service, a notable feature helping facilitate access for everyone.
Rail replacements and bus services are conveniently accessible, with bus stops located just a short stroll away from the station, particularly near the HiQ Garage on Stuart Road. Taxi services can also be arranged via the Cab4You service, connecting travelers with local taxi operators for seamless transfers. While bicycle hire is not available directly at the station, cyclists can make use of limited bicycle storage spaces in the car park area.
